Default Luhn Performance

Use caution when dealing with this company. Business ethics and quality are very questionable.
I purchased an oil pump from Luhn Performance and it failed but the way it was handled was the real issue for me just bad customer service. After the failure, I called to discuss the issue with Mark. He agreed with our diagnosis of the issue (he said, she said I know nothing in writing). He also agreed to refund my purchase price and even offered to help with the expenses. Since “stuff happens” I told him just the purchase price would be great. I returned the bad pump but failed to return it complete unknown to me at the time. The machine shop I use bagged the relief spring and Marks relief ball assembly separate from the pump to avoid further damage. After 30-days I had not received the refund so I sent a text inquiring about the return. After receiving my text and sitting on the return for 30 business days he replied that the relief spring and check ball assembly were missing. I was unaware of this until the reply.

I checked with the machine shop and they searched but could not find the parts. I sent Mark many texts asking how he would like to handle it and to please elaborate what exactly was missing. I received no response at all. After seven days of no communication from Mark/Luhn Performance my machine shop called me explaining that they had found what they believed to be the missing part and explained why it was not in the pump. I sent Mark an e-mail asking if he was still willing to refund the money I would ship the part. No response again. I arrived home that night on the eighth day from when I was informed about the missing parts so 38 days later to find a package from Luhn performance on my porch. Inside the box was the pump completely disassembled and missing parts that were shipped to Luhn. They failed to return the pickup tube, mounting bolts for the pickup tube and a spare pickup that was returned to Luhn performance in my original shipment. Since then numerous attempts have been made to just get the missing items returned to me with no success. So now I have an incomplete and useless high dollar pump. I am out the purchase price along with property that I paid good money for. Additionally, I have lost the cost of a complete engine tear down and new bearings due to his product. If you choose to do business with this company good luck. Don’t expect any support or any product quality. Check everything! Do yourself a favor and just stick with known parts suppliers/companies that work with their customers and have a proven track record!
